¿Cómo arreglar los iconos que faltan en la barra de tareas y el menú de inicio? [duplicar]

44

Esta pregunta ya tiene una respuesta aquí:

Instalé Visual Studio 2012 ayer y durante la instalación, mi camino de alguna manera se arruinó 1 . Desde entonces, los íconos para aplicaciones que forman parte de Windows son el ícono "desconocido" predeterminado, pero otros íconos están bien. Las aplicaciones que los accesos directos enlazan para iniciarse bien cuando se hace clic en los iconos.

Barra de tareas:

Barra de tareas

Menu de inicio:

Menu de inicio

He arreglado mi camino, pero los iconos aún se muestran incorrectamente.

¿Alguna idea sobre cómo vaciar lo que parece ser un conjunto de iconos en caché?


1 Algo tomó un camino de A; B; C; D; y lo convirtió en A; B; C; D; A; B; C; D; E; F; - duplicando una gran parte de ese punto hasta el punto de que no había más caracteres disponibles para escribir en el cuadro de edición en las propiedades del sistema. Esto tuvo el efecto secundario de que Windows informaba que no podía encontrar% windir%.

adrianbanks
fuente
¿Has intentado cerrar sesión y volver a iniciarla? ¿O reiniciando la computadora?
Indrek
@ Indrek: Sí, he reiniciado varias veces.
adrianbanks
1
Verifique la ruta de espacio (s) después de a; lo que hace que se salte todo lo que haya pasado ese punto. Un camino de A; B; C; D; E; F solo se vería como A; B; C. Microsoft realmente necesita un editor decente para la variable de entorno de ruta. Publicar la (s) variable (s) de entorno de ruta también debería permitir que otros detecten problemas
Brian
@Brian: no, no hay espacios presentes.
adrianbanks
¿Has intentado recrear el caché de iconos? Vea los iconos de escritorio de Windows 7 corruptos
Ƭᴇcʜιᴇ007

Respuestas:

82

He resuelto el problema del icono de la siguiente manera:

  1. Inicio del administrador de tareas
  2. Finalización del proceso explorer.exe (haga clic derecho en explorer.exe -> Finalizar proceso)
  3. Abrir una ventana de línea de comandos (Archivo -> Nueva tarea (Ejecutar ...) -> Escriba cmd.exe)
  4. En la ventana cmd escriba
    cd% userprofile% \ appdata \ local
  5. Ahora necesita eliminar el archivo iconcache.db
    del iconcache.db / a 
  6. Salga de la ventana cmd escribiendo
    salida
  7. Iniciar el explorador nuevamente (Archivo -> Nueva tarea (Ejecutar ...) -> Escriba explorer.exe)

Ahora debería poder ver los iconos restaurados.

Mario Neubauer
fuente
1
Usted señor, es un caballero y un santo. ¡Perfecto! Ojalá pudiera votar tu respuesta más.
Pace
Éste funciona como encanto
starcorn
44
Genial, respuesta perfecta. Debería ser el aceptado.
Jorge Campos
Esto también funciona para mí
Luciano Mammino
Excelente! Funciona perfecto !!
Daniel Silva
13

para mí, la función de anclar y desanclar de la barra de tareas funcionó

Hans Wurst
fuente
No puedo creer que esto haya funcionado. Guau.
RubberDuck
5

Eventualmente resolví esto siguiendo los consejos dados aquí , aunque no los consejos en el artículo sino los consejos en uno de los comentarios:

cambie momentáneamente la profundidad de color de la pantalla a 16 bits, por ejemplo, y, cuando Windows le pregunte si desea mantener los cambios o no, haga clic en "No" para restaurar la configuración original.

Los consejos en el cuerpo principal del artículo (sobre cómo cambiar la vista de la configuración de carpetas y archivos ocultos) no funcionaron.

adrianbanks
fuente
Sí, algo que ver con el almacenamiento en caché de iconos. Tuve un problema similar con la desaparición de mi icono de Chrome. Después de un formato largamente esperado, está bien ahora.
Piotr Kula
2

Creo que perder los íconos es solo uno de los síntomas de un problema más amplio, que es que la variable PATH se equivoca. Vea la siguiente discusión en el foro de VisualStudio . El problema parece ser causado por una PATHvariable excesivamente larga .

Daniel Gehriger
fuente
La respuesta de @ MarioNeubauer funcionó para mí una vez, y luego volvió y eso no lo solucionó la segunda vez. Esta fue la respuesta final.
Scott Whitlock
0

Hice clic derecho en el elemento con el icono que falta y elegí propiedades. En el cuadro de diálogo de propiedades, hice clic para cambiar el icono. Cambié el ícono (por ejemplo, del ícono principal del programa al ícono de documento para ese programa) y presioné OK (tenía que tener derechos de administrador para confirmar). Luego repetí el proceso para volver a cambiar el icono, en ese momento el icono ahora era visible.

Ben
fuente